An advertisement card dated November 1931. George H. Gutteridge's store offers gifts and watch, clock, and jewelry repair. The store is located at 15 Nason Street, Maynard, Mass. The telephone number is 115.

This was a confidential report to the Directors of the Bradley Container Corporation after its first year of operation. It is a first-person account, presumably by the company president, Bradley Dewey (or another high-ranking executive).

From the Special acts and resolves passed by the General Court of Massachusetts

Chap. 0198 An Act to Incorporate the Town of Maynard.

Be it enacted, Sfc, as follows:

Section 1. All the territory now within the towns of Stow and Sudbury,…

A Boston Sunday Globe publication that celebrates the 100th birthday of Abraham Lincoln, February 12, 1809. It was printed for the children of New England and their parents and shares his life's story 100 years after his birth.

The sixth grade report card of Eino Nyholm, 1921-22, when he attended the Roosevelt School. The teacher was Mabel T. Bliss.

A collection of 62 pressed plants (flower, stem, leaf, seed} with their descriptions, all found in Maynard. The plants where collected between April 22 and June 10, 1899.
Shown is Cornus florida, Flowering Dogwood
